LANSING – Michigan currently has 2,149 inmates aged 65 or older, accounting for 6.7% of the state’s total prison population of 32,265, according to data from Jenni Riehle, the public information officer for the Department of Corrections.

ESCANABA — Each year on Boxing Day, the Delta County Historical Society opens its museum and the Sand Point Lighthouse to visitors free of charge. This year, both buildings will open to the public from 1 to 4 p.m. Friday and Saturday for the annual Christmas Open House.

A 61-year-old Luxemburg, Wis., man died Sunday when the snowmobile he was operating left a trail in Gogebic County and hit a wooden post, according to Michigan State Police at the Wakefield Post.
